After a week of intense drama following the UDF’s landslide victory in the 2026 Assembly elections, the Congress High Command is set to announce the next Chief Minister this Thursday, May 14. The state has been buzzing with anticipation as three major frontrunners—V.D. Satheesan, K.C. Venugopal, and Ramesh Chennithala—vie for the top spot. While Satheesan is widely credited for leading the UDF to its massive 102-seat win, Venugopal remains a powerful contender with strong support from the party’s central leadership in Delhi.
The decision comes after marathon meetings in New Delhi between Congress President Mallikarjun Kharge and Rahul Gandhi. While posters supporting different leaders have popped up across Thiruvananthapuram, party insiders suggest the choice will focus on someone who can maintain the UDF’s newfound momentum. Most alliance partners, including the IUML, are reportedly leaning toward Satheesan, but the “High Command” will have the final say.
